Hi Justtom:  The Gillette Fat Handle Tech is an excellent DE razor for any newbie or beginner or veteran shaver.  It is probably one of my favorite vintage razors.  It is considered a mild and effective razor.  If you can get a good to near mint condition for $30 and under go for it.  I have the gold-plated one.  The nickel-plated Techs have longer lasting finishes (coatings).  The gold-plated Techs lose their coatings more.  With that said....it is still a classic, beautiful razor that performs well.  Here is my Gillette Tech.
